Output 4640588fc90e00104dcf990118094fffec9c6bca222c90c52624f536987d6207:0

value
2900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4619b0523a75b4521b7ed571e14f5b5726bb0275 OP_EQUALVERIFY OP_CHECKSIG
address
17Pf5KDdBTfc3z6rAnLKjLhLBjqFCGAEDK
transaction
4640588fc90e00104dcf990118094fffec9c6bca222c90c52624f536987d6207
spent
true